您当前的位置:首页 > 百宝箱

aspnetcore源码解读

2024-09-30 21:06:56 作者:石家庄人才网

本篇文章给大家带来《aspnetcore源码解读》,石家庄人才网对文章内容进行了深度展开说明,希望对各位有所帮助,记得收藏本站。

ASP.NET Core 是一个跨平台的开源框架,用于构建现代的、基于云的 Web 应用程序。它速度快、轻量级且模块化,使其成为构建各种应用程序的绝佳选择。

解读 ASP.NET Core 源码可以帮助你深入了解框架的内部工作机制。你可以了解请求如何被处理、如何配置服务以及不同的组件如何协同工作。这对于想要扩展框架、编写自定义组件或只是想更深入地了解 ASP.NET Core 的开发人员非常有用。

以下是一些解读 ASP.NET Core 源码的技巧:

  • 从 GitHub 上克隆 ASP.NET Core 存储库。
  • 使用 Visual Studio 或 Visual Studio Code 等 IDE 打开解决方案。
  • 从 `Program.cs` 文件开始,这是应用程序的入口点。
  • 使用调试器逐步执行代码并查看不同方法的调用方式。
  • 查阅文档和博客文章以获取有关特定组件或功能的更多信息。

解读 ASP.NET Core 源码可能具有挑战性,但这也是一个很好的学习机会。通过花时间了解框架的内部工作机制,你可以成为一名更优秀的 ASP.NET Core 开发人员。石家庄人才网小编建议你从你感兴趣的特定组件或功能开始,并逐步深入了解。

例如,如果你对 ASP.NET Core 的路由机制感兴趣,你可以从 `Startup.cs` 文件中的 `Configure` 方法开始,该方法定义了应用程序的请求处理管道。然后,你可以查看 `UseRouting` 和 `UseEndpoints` 方法,它们负责配置路由。

解读 ASP.NET Core 源码是一个持续的过程。随着你对框架的了解越来越多,你将能够更深入地了解其内部工作机制。石家庄人才网小编相信,花时间解读源码是值得的,因为它将帮助你成为一名更优秀、更高效的 ASP.NET Core 开发人员。

石家庄人才网小编对《aspnetcore源码解读》内容分享到这里,如果有相关疑问请在本站留言。

版权声明:《aspnetcore源码解读》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/baibaoxiang/3463.html